PHP內核定義變量的方式
對於PHP的擴展開發和內核應用,寸謀的翻譯真心不錯,講的很有條理,只要大家回想起來C語言的基礎語法,這就不是問題。
關於PHP的生命周期,以PHP變量在內核中的實現
感觸最深的就是變量檢索中的HashTable.
php 內核中定義好了很多的函數來直接操作不同的數據類型,同一種方法,每個數據類型都有一個。
也許在內核中的設計不會直接反應在PHP程序設計上,但還是思想上裏外貫通的思想如果可以領會到,真的可以讓你不懼怕任何的錯誤提示,至少你知道它為何這麽提示,也許解決的方案一時想不起來,但是隨時都可以想明白如何解決,只是是不是很優秀的解決方式。
本文出自 “一站式解決方案” 博客,請務必保留此出處http://10725691.blog.51cto.com/10715691/1954228
PHP內核定義變量的方式
相關推薦
PHP內核定義變量的方式
php內核使用對於PHP的擴展開發和內核應用,寸謀的翻譯真心不錯,講的很有條理,只要大家回想起來C語言的基礎語法,這就不是問題。關於PHP的生命周期,以PHP變量在內核中的實現感觸最深的就是變量檢索中的HashTable.php 內核中定義好了很多的函數來直接操作不同的數據類型,同一種方法,每個數據類型都有一
Windows內核重要變量
shared ssdt initial dha 著名 out pep 創建線程 sin IST_ENTRY PsLoadedModuleList; [定 義] wrk\wrk-v1.2\base\ntos\mm\Sysload.c [初始化] wrk\wrk-v1.2\b
操作系統,編程語言分類,執行python兩種方式,變量,內存管理,定義變量的三個特征
什麽 height 取代 沒有 一個 Coding 開發 軟件 簡單 操作系統 1、什麽是操作系統 操作系統位於計算機硬件與應用軟件之間 是一個協調、管理、控制計算機硬件資源與軟件資源的控制程序2、為何要有操作系統? 1、控制硬件 2、把對硬件的復雜
跟廠長學PHP內核7(六):變量之zval
extend bject mbo sta ast lar als ESS 內存大小 記得網上流傳甚廣的段子“PHP是世界上最好的語言”,暫且不去討論是否言過其實,但至少PHP確實有獨特優勢的,比如它的弱類型,即只需要$符號即可聲明變量,使得PHP入手門檻極低,成為大家所青
操作系統、編程語言分類、變量、內存管理、定義變量
解釋器 value Go 需要 比較 應該 強調 調試 dbo 1,什麽是操作系統 操作系統就是軟件與硬件之間的一個操作程序。 2、為什麽要有操作系統 (1)控制硬件 (2)把控制硬件的接口做成一個完美的接口,供用戶使用。 3、操作系統的三大組成 應用程序 : 操作系統
js中三種定義變量的方式const, var, let的區別。
ole con 函數調用 ons 調用 定義 函數 fin UNC const var let區別 1.const 定義的變量不可以修改,而且必須初始化 const a = 3;正確 const a;錯誤,必須初始化 console.log("函數外const定義a
linux 內核信號量
hid 資源 你在 spf href driver 釋放 相同 部分 Linux內核的信號量在概念和原理上和用戶態的System V的IPC機制信號量是相同的,不過他絕不可能在內核之外使用,因此他和System V的IPC機制信號量毫不相幹。 信號量在創建時需要設置一個
一個簡單演示樣例來演示用PHP訪問表單變量
time 變量 value 購物車 size post方法 form sso val 首先編寫表單頁面orderform.html,用post方法請求服務端腳本文件:processorder.php orderform.html: <!DOCTYPE html&
深入理解php內核 編寫擴展 I:介紹PHP和Zend
保持 理論 ifd gem counter 被調用 builds 讀取 添加 內容: 編寫擴展I - PHP和Zend起步 原文:http://devzone.zend.com/public/view/tag/Extension Part I: Introduction
存儲過程的使用——定義變量
定義 變量 use set upd 定義變量 lar bold sel 一、定義變量 --簡單賦值 declare @a int set @a=5 print @a --使用select語句賦值 declare @user1 nvarchar(50) sel
smarty模板自定義變量
charset -c 1.0 截取字符串 p s mysqli 參數 gin plugin 一、通過smarty方式調用變量調節器 <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"htt
002-自定義變量
blog ron 查看 報錯 註意 images strong width logs 定義 變量名=變量值 例如: x=5 y=7 註意:在=的前後,不能出現空格 調用 用 $ 符號調用 疊加 方法一: 使用 " " 方法二: 使
高端技巧:怎樣使用#define定義變量
有一個 add ret 由於 能夠 ext lan article pop Introduction 想在源文件裏定義一個跟行號有關的變量,每次都手動輸入實在是太慢了。本文介紹怎樣使用宏定義來定義與行號有關的變量。 比如:我們想在源碼的第10行定義A
PHP超全局變量
tco 全局 star 操作 tar 刪除 函數 參數 coo PHP在設計的時候已經預定義了9個超級全局變量、8個魔術變量和13魔術函數,這些變量和函數可以在腳本的任何地方不用聲明就可以使用。 在PHP開發會頻繁的使用這些變量和函數,這些變量和函數可以方便的幫我們解決
【php】global的使用與php的全局變量
popu 執行 生效 -m content 聲明 一個 無法 編程 php的全局變量和其余編程語言是不同的,在大多數的編程語言中,全局變量在其下的函數、類中自己主動生效。除非被局部變量覆蓋,或者根本就不同意再聲明同樣名稱與類型的局部變量。可是php中的全局變量不是默
linux 定義變量 ,添加變量值
ech 輸出變量 path bin 定義 添加 echo 增加 linux 1.設置值$name=test2. 輸出變量的值 echo $echo $name3. 增加變量內容PATH=$PATH:/home/bin/testPATH="$PATH":/home/bin/
Oracle之PL/SQL編程_數據類型與定義變量和常量
oracle 數據類型 變量 常量-----------------------------------基本數據類型-----------------------------------1.數值類型NUMBER(P,S)參數 P 表示精度,參數 S 表示刻度範圍。精度是指數值中所有有效數字的個數,而刻度範圍是
shell 定義變量 坑
div aced 。。 cdir deb col vda 結果 see debugDir = "/debugExamples" releaseDir = "/releaseExamples" docDir="../../../mew_devdata/interfac
php的註釋、變量、類型、常量、運算符、比較符、條件語句;
小數 array cas 單引號 標識 php 規則 tro 特殊 php的註釋 1.// 2.# 3./* */ 變量 變量是儲存信息的容器; 變量規則: 1.變量以$開頭,後面跟名稱》》》$sum; 2.變量必須以字母或下滑先開頭,不能用數字開頭; 3.變量名稱對大小
php中unset一個變量之後, 通過引用賦值引用這個變量的變量會被unset嗎?
是否 有著 amp 如果 存在 其他 得到 val 發現 在php中變量的賦值分為按值賦值, 和引用賦值. 在按值賦值中, $a = val; $b = $a ; 可以看成$a = val; $b =val;變量b被賦予a的值之後, a和b便沒有任何的引用關系了, 此